Biscayne Park vice mayor presses colleagues to enforce 10‑day item submission rule; manager to place change on next meeting

Village of Biscayne Park Commission · January 14, 2026
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

Vice mayor raised repeated concerns that commission agenda items she submitted within the 10‑day deadline were excluded, prompting a pledge to place a rules-review discussion next month and several pulled consent items to be refiled.

Vice Mayor (name recorded in meeting transcript as speaker 2) told the Village of Biscayne Park commission she had submitted multiple agenda items at least 10 days before the meeting but those items were not included on the published agenda.
